Understanding Wood Floor Installation

What is Hardwood Floor Installation?

Hardwood flooring setup describes the process of setting wood planks in an assigned area to develop a long lasting and visually attractive surface. This can entail different techniques, consisting of nail-down, glue-down, and drifting techniques, relying on the kind of wood floor covering chosen.

Types of Hardwood Flooring

Solid Hardwood

Solid hardwood floorings are made from a solitary piece of wood and commonly been available in densities varying from 3/4 inch to 5/16 inch.

Engineered Hardwood

Engineered wood includes multiple layers, making it a lot more flexible and secure than strong wood. It's less prone to contorting as a result of modifications in humidity.

Preparing Your Subfloor for Installation

Importance of Subfloor Preparation

A well-prepared subfloor is essential for attaining an expert search in your do it yourself hardwood flooring installation. An unequal or poorly installed subfloor can lead to squeaks and various other problems down the line.

Steps for Preparing Your Subfloor

Clean Extensively: Get rid of all particles and dust. Check Levelness: Make use of a leveling tool; load reduced places with leveling substance if necessary. Repair Any Damages: Fix cracks or openings in concrete subfloors or change damaged plywood panels.

Installing Underlayment

What is Underlayment?

Underlayment is an extra layer positioned underneath hardwood flooring that helps with audio absorption and wetness protection.

image

Selecting Underlayment Material

Choose an underlayment suitable with your chosen flooring kind-- options consist of foam sheets or felt paper developed particularly for hardwood installations.
